Director, Alumni & Family Engagement

Jacksonville UniversityJacksonville, FL
Onsite

About The Position

The Office of University Advancement at Jacksonville University is currently seeking a seasoned and strategic professional to lead the development of alumni, parent, and family engagement. This fundraising and engagement professional will implement cultivation, engagement, and stewardship strategies for alumni and family annual giving and leadership donors, contributing to the overall engagement pipeline. This leadership role reports to the Senior Director of Engagement who reports to the Vice President, University Advancement. University Advancement oversees all University fundraising activities; constituent engagement, including select student, alumni, donor, and family engagement; constituent data collection and management; and stewardship efforts related to institutional advancement. The department works collaboratively across campus with all divisions, particularly Athletics, Marketing & Communications, Enrollment, and Student Engagement.
